The court left Faig Amirov custody
The Nasimi District Court of Baku dismissed the petition on the transfer of the financial director of the newspaper "Azadlig" Faig Amirov to house arrest for health reasons, according to his lawyer Agil Laidjev. He recalled that Amirov suffers from stomach, and in the jail he does not have dietary food and necessary treatment. Amirov was arrested in August 2016 . He was charged under Articles 283.1 (inciting religious hatred) and 168.1 (infringement of human rights under the pretext of performing religious rites) of the Criminal Code. The investigation accuses him due to the Movement of "Khizmat" by Fethullah Gulen, who was announced in Turkey announced an organizer of the failed coup d'etat in July 2016.-05B06—

The Ministry of Digital Development and Transport of Azerbaijan has effectively acknowledged that President Ilham Aliyev’s official aircraft, “Baku-1,” encountered external technical interference while flying to St. Petersburg for the informal summit of the Commonwealth of Independent States (CIS) on December 25. The revelation comes amid growing scrutiny of the incident, including reports of a GPS signal loss over Russian airspace.
